Other reasons for camming:
  • No pressure from bosses and co-workers to meet the goals that they dish out. Plus if you have a bad few cam shifts you won't as likely get fired over it. (Pressures from members from time to time, but I don't mind banning bullies)
  • Unfriendly customer? No need to suck up. Just ban em.
  • Slowly you begin to learn (hopefully) that if someone doesn't like your body type or personality, it's like them not choosing the same favorite color as others. Does anyone really care if a person's favorite color is blue when they like red? No. I don't care if someone prefers blondes over brunettes or petite over chubby. I personally have an a tendency to lean more toward redheads, but that doesn't mean everyone else should.
  • A huge sense of self-accomplishment feelz happens after you learn coding, gif making, lighting tricks etc.
  • I learned to be very assertive and even confrontational because of camming. I'd go as far as saying I'm pretty addicted to butting in when I feel like it'll be interesting to me (for example how I first butted in and mentioned you here.) ^.^;
  • People with anxiety like myself often have issues with getting in touch with other humans. Is it the same as meeting other people in person? No. However it's nice interacting like a real life people when I'm typically a hermit. I've gotten much better throughout the years in socializing offline, but I feel camming was a stepping stone for me to that point.
  • As long as you're open-minded and good at taking criticism it makes for a great way to learn more about yourself and improve.
So sure I wouldn't necessarily recommend camming to someone who had say issues with their body or gets depressed when people for whatever reason don't like them. I'd be honest that it has it's downsides with potential stalkers and such, however on the whole can actually be a very good experience even for a person who isn't looking into it for the money.

Don't get me wrong. I won't do things for free. It is my job and I don't take well to feeling like a doormat. Also maybe I have it totally backwards, but I feel as long as the member is being respectful and paying what the cammer asks, I feel they are more likely to think of the person as a person than an object even on a screen. A few times in my life I worked for big corporations that paid me by the hour, and if I didn't do things perfectly by a high-paying customer's perfectionist standards. I'd get penalized even if it was something illogical due to the company wanting the customer to feel they were always right. I wasn't allowed to accept tips, and frankly felt more like an object in that atmosphere a hundred times more than I do working at my own pace and with my own rules.
